Responsibilities

  • Maintenance of the highest clinical standards in the management of patients undergoing anaesthesia.
  • To undertake sessions in vascular theatres, vascular pre‑assessment clinics and MDTs in the vascular anaesthesia service. The job will also involve working flexibly to cover various surgical specialities via job planning.
  • To undertake duties as part of the on‑call out of hours rota covering general emergency, maternity theatre and paediatric emergencies.
  • To work constructively and flexibly with colleagues in the Department of Anaesthesia, Intensive Care Medicine and Integrated Pain Management to provide the best care for patients.
  • Teaching and training of intermediate grade and junior medical staff, nursing staff and medical students.
  • To actively participate in both departmental and Trust matters concerning Clinical Governance and audit.
  • To have responsibility for and actively participate in Continuing Professional Development (CPD). The Trust is committed to providing the time and financial support for these activities.

This is an exciting opportunity to join the expanding anaesthetic department at Luton & Dunstable Hospital as a vascular anaesthetist. Vascular services will be translocated to the Luton site from Bedford with the expansion of arterial vascular service  appointee will anaesthetise specifically for specialist vascular lists and a variety of other elective surgical specialties. The non‑resident on‑call commitment covers emergency surgery and obstetrics.

The appointee will participate in a 1:20 on‑call commitment based at Luton & Dunstable Hospital.
